People in Business

Christine Kitchen was named outpatient services manager at Shriners Hospitals for Children — St. Louis.

Stephanie Scott was promoted to vice president of support services and strategy for the St. Louis Arc.

Lindenwood University President John Porter was elected to the Midwest BankCentre St. Charles advisory board.

Bill Smothers joined Kwame Building Group Inc. as chief estimator.

Kyle Boschert was promoted to HVAC service manager at Wiegmann Associates.

Steven WilsonWesley Barnes and Victor Hernandez joined 4M Building Solutions as account managers. Wendy Castro and Sandra Hinman were hired as regional coordinators.

Benjamin F. Edwards & Co. hired David Frank as co-head of the investment banking division.

Dr. Herluf G. Lund Jr. of St. Louis Cosmetic Surgery was elected president of The Aesthetic Society, a worldwide organization of of board-certified plastic surgeons.

Andrea Lampert, former vice president of talent strategies at BJC HealthCare, joined technology consulting firm Perficient Inc. as vice president of people.
